Review: Costal Glasses


I originally heard about Coastal from a co-worker. She seemed to wearing a new pair of trendy glasses every day of the week. She told Coastal lets you have your first pair of frames for free. She directed me to their facebook page.






A few months later it was time for an eye exam. I looked up what information Coastal would need. I go to Sears Optical for eye exams. They handed me my prescription after my exam. I was so excited. I went home and ordered my first pair. Putting my prescription in was very simple. They also have a live chat option if you have any questions.
I happened to be unlucky enough to order my glasses around the time the FDA was changing their standards for contacts and glasses. My glasses ended up getting stuck in Tennessee for over a month. People on facebook were furious. There was no making them happy.
I posted a comment saying that it wasn't Coastal's fault that the FDA wouldn't release our glasses. Complaining on Coastal's facebook page wouldn't get your glasses out the FDA's hands any quicker.

A few days after that I received an anonomus package. It wasn't anywhere near my birthday. I was pretty confused.
It was filled with all sorts of goodies, but where did it come from.
This was from Coastal. It BLEW MY MIND!! I had paid $12 for my glasses and this box was worth twice that.
I ended up ordering another pair of glasses while I was waiting for my first pair. It got to my house within a week.
When you order glasses from Coastal they come in a case and you get a glasses cleaning kit/ repair kit as well. Sometimes ordering glasses that you can't try on can be concering. Coastal gives you 365 days to return/ exchange you glasses.
Here is what comes in the cleaning and repair kit. The small silver piece has all sorts of screw drivers and such.
I love these cat eye frames. My mom had always been agains thick frames. Until this pair all my frames had been wiry and thin. Buying thick frames made me feel a little rebellious.
I eventually received my second pair. They were perfect. They were like a cat eye version of the current hipster glasses look. I have gotten TONS of compliments on both pairs. In the end I think I paid $12 for each pair. That was just the cost of the lenses.
